			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Babies seem to have some much cute stuff from the hospital. I found this frame at Target. It&#8217;s by &#8220;Sprouts&#8221; and it cost about $8. I made a similar display for Gavin 3 1/2 years ago, although it has less decoration.</p>
<p><a title="ScrapFrame" href="http://www.craftsyoucando.com/wp-content/uploads/2007/03/img_1255.JPG"><img id="image51" height="400" alt="img_1255.JPG" src="http://www.craftsyoucando.com/wp-content/uploads/2007/03/img_1255.JPG" width="400" /></a> </p>
<p>This paper is by K &#038; Co. It&#8217;s called &#8220;Quilt Blocks&#8221; I attached one of Addison&#8217;s sonogram pictures along with her birth announcement photo and the ribbon from a gift we received. I also included her hospital bracelet, hospital hat, and her birth announcement from our local newspaper.</p>
<p>I used Zots adhesive from Hobby Lobby to attach the bracelet and hat. The flowers are Making Memories and are attached with brads.  Total time to complete 45 minutes after I decided what pictures to include!!</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>It has been a Moody Family Tradition since we were married and living in an apartment to get a Christmas Tree. The first few years they were &#8220;Charlie Brown&#8221; trees very small and kind of homely looking. In recent years we get a huggable tree! This is our measuring device. If we can stretch out our arms around the tree and touch it will fit in our house.</p>
<p>This year we went to a really cute farm called Chestnut Charlies! We always go with Peter&#8217;s parents and now this year we took both of the kids, although from the picture you can tell Addison thought it was a real snooze!</p>
<p><a title="XmasTree" href="http://www.craftsyoucando.com/wp-content/uploads/2007/03/img_0885.JPG"><img id="image45" height="400" alt="img_0885.JPG" src="http://www.craftsyoucando.com/wp-content/uploads/2007/03/img_0885.JPG" width="400" /></a></p>
<p>Pine Tree Paper is by &#8220;The Paper Studio&#8221;. Red Barn Stripes is by &#8220;Rusty Pickle&#8221;.  XMAS TREES sign is by Karen Foster. Pine trees are Sizziz diecuts. The 2006 is Making Memories Rub-ons. This was a super easy layout.</p>
<p>Total time to complete this layout 30 minutes.</p>
